May the profound ideas of this great Englishman continue to inspire all

Christ's followers in this land to conform their every thought, word and

action to Christ, and to work strenuously to defend those unchanging moral

truths which, taken up, illuminated and confirmed by the Gospel, stand at

the foundation of a truly humane, just and free society.

How much contemporary society needs this witness! How much we need,

in the Church and in society, witnesses of the beauty of holiness, witnesses of

the splendour of truth, witnesses of the joy and freedom born of a living

relationship with Christ! One of the greatest challenges facing us today is

how to speak convincingly of the wisdom and liberating power of God's word

to a world which all too often sees the Gospel as a constriction of human

freedom, instead of the truth which liberates our minds and enlightens our

efforts to live wisely and well, both as individuals and as members of society.

Let us pray, then, that the Catholics of this land will become ever more

conscious of their dignity as a priestly people, called to consecrate the world

to God through lives of faith and holiness. And may this increase of apostolic

zeal be accompanied by an outpouring of prayer for vocations to the ordained

priesthood. For the more the lay apostolate grows, the more urgently the

need for priests is felt; and the more the laity's own sense of vocation is

deepened, the more what is proper to the priest stands out. May many young

men in this land find the strength to answer the Master's call to the minis-

terial priesthood, devoting their lives, their energy and their talents to God,

thus building up his people in unity and fidelity to the Gospel, especially

through the celebration of the Eucharistic sacrifice.

Dear friends, in this Cathedral of the Most Precious Blood, I invite you

once more to look to Christ, who leads us in our faith and brings it to

perfection.10 I ask you to unite yourselves ever more fully to the Lord, shar-

ing in his sacrifice on the Cross and offering him that "spiritual worship" 11

which embraces every aspect of our lives and finds expression in our efforts to

contribute to the coming of his Kingdom. I pray that, in doing so, you may

join the ranks of faithful believers throughout the long Christian history of

this land in building a society truly worthy of man, worthy of your nation's

highest traditions.
